Scott Meyer: The future of learning and web3 (Part 2)
Scott Meyer (@MrScottMeyer) is the founder of ed3.gg - a consultancy and studio working to scale education. His weekly newsletter at digest.ed3.gg provides insights on the intersection of web3 and education. He previously launched an entrepreneurship center at a university, built an accelerated education program for adult learners, served as a city councilor, and ran a digital marketing agency. He is the proud and busy father to four and is based in Fargo, ND - yes, like the movie.

Nick Ducoff: The future of learning and web3 (Part 1)
Nick co-founded two venture-backed tech companies that were acquired, and was previously a college vice president and startup lawyer. He co-authored Better Off After College, which was a #1 Amazon bestseller. He's currently exploring the intersection of learning, earning, and web3, contributing as Semester Lead at Crypto, Culture & Society DAO. He's also a Seed Club collaborator for SC04. Nick is an active angel investor in web3 companies such as Flipside Crypto, Catalog, and others listed at https://nick.vc.
This interview is about what is he thinking on his thesis when it comes to web3 and education and talk about the experiments between learning, earning, web3.
